Some experience in cabling or low voltage preferred, will train the right person Essential Functions Install, maintain, and service copper and fiber optic cabling for: Network infrastructure Access control systems Video systems Telephone services Primary Roles & Responsibilities Install cable pathways, cable trays, and equipment racks Install and service: Low-voltage category cabling Fiber optic cabling Communications cabling and equipment Work with Category 3, Category 5, Category 6, and Fiber Optic Structured Cabling systems Perform cabling upgrades and additions Evaluate, diagnose, troubleshoot, and repair cabling issues Complete required documentation accurately and timely Transport tools, equipment, and supplies as needed Competencies Proven ability to install, terminate, and test low-voltage cabling, including: Twisted pair Coax Power-limited tray cable Stranded and solid conductor low-voltage cable Fiber optic cable Experience installing cable pathways and conveyance systems (ladders, trays, support systems) Knowledge of through-wall penetration systems Strong understanding of telecom, data, security, and wireless cabling infrastructure Ability to read blueprints and architectural, mechanical, and electrical drawings Ability to interpret floor plans, wiring diagrams, and installation documentation Mechanical aptitude Working knowledge of industry standards:
BICSI ANSI EIA/TIA
Local and National Electrical Code Physical Requirements Ability to carry up to 30 lbs and lift up to 50 lbs Ability to climb ladders and work at heights #ber
